Opportunities at Carcanet

 Freelancers:

Carcanet uses a very small pool of freelance editors and proofreaders. Freelances who would like to work for the press are welcome to send their CV with a covering letter to info@carcanet.co.uk, but are strongly advised to study the website first to familiarise themselves with the kinds of books Carcanet publishes. Only appropriately trained and experienced freelancers will be considered. If we think that we may be able to offer you work in the future, we will acknowledge your letter and keep your CV on file.
Work Experience:

During the covid-19 outbreak and its aftermath Carcanet regrets to say that its internship programme has had to be suspended. Because remote and hybrid working are now in place, it has been impossible to restart the programme. As soon as it can resume we will remove this notice from the application page and welcome applications once again.

Carcanet offers one-week work experience placements in the Sales & Marketing department. If you think you may be interested in publishing and/or sales and marketing as a possible career, a one-week placement will give you a brief glimpse into the industry. Please note that we cannot offer editorial work experience.

We aim to provide general information on the publishing industry and how it works, and the opportunity to shadow a range of tasks typically associated with sales and marketing, as well as insight into other departments and the overall structure of the office.

Please note, we can only accept applications from people 18 years old and over and you must have eligibility to work in the UK. Work experience placements last for five days, Monday to Friday, and are unpaid. These placements are in very high demand and sadly we cannot offer a place to everyone who applies, though we will respond to all applicants. We are a very small team, and it may take some time for us to get back to you. Please allow at least three weeks before chasing your application.
